Great Tour

Reviewed by: Lisa B., 2008/11/17

This was great and well worth the money. I would have liked to stay longer in a couple of areas and there were some activities that we didn't get to do because of time. I would suggest taking snacks or packing a picnic as you really didn't have time to buy a lunch. At a couple of the attractions you were offered ice cream to buy, but not anything more substantial. Both the dinner entertainment and the Polynesian show after dinner were awesome. Going back a 2nd time, I would go on my own and wander.

Half-day Polynesian Cultural center

Reviewed by: Mary, 2008/10/13

The show was great and we enjoyed it very much. The rest of the experience was so-so. Our driver was 30 min. late and we were rushed into the park with most of the villages already closed for the day. The dinner was again rushed and we were seated during the end of the show which appeared to have been great. The little we saw of it was really funny. The food left a bit to be desired. But then we went to the Horizon show and it was awesome. I guess when you go to the half day show you're really just getting the great evening show. Next time I'll know to go to some other luau and go to the cultural center during the day to really see what's there. Feel like we missed a lot.

Polynesian Cultural Center

Reviewed by: Mr. Anonymous, 2008/07/22

We really had a great time at the center and learned a great deal. You really need to get a guide to get the most information on each village and so you don't end up going in circles or getting lost in the center. The guide keeps you on track and know when the shows are scheduled and the best places to sit. The food was exceptional. Our seats were in the sun and we wish we could have sat in the shade....that was our only complaint. The sun didn't stay up long and we soon forgot about it. Overall we had a really great time and would do it again!
